13Automobilista 2
A Realistic Racing Experience Covering A Wide Variety Of Segments
Since its release on Steam in 2020,Automobilista 2has received good scores from critics and high ratings among players. Earlier in 2022, this solid racing sim, which is alsogreat in Virtual Reality, was given the Steam Deck’s green light of approval, making this a great game to play on handheld devices.
Automobilista 2is renowned for having excellent graphics, and the frame rate on the Steam Deck can be cranked up to 60fps with few to no issues. Even serious sim racers can enjoyAutomobilista 2on Valve’s impressive handheld system.

AlthoughF1 24is already out, the latest game in the franchise that is verified for Steam Deck isF1 22, whichis another extremely solid entry in Codemaster’sFormula Onefranchise. It is a gorgeous game, with cars and circuits that look as close to real life as fans have ever seen before.F1 22added F1 Life mode and the ability to crossplay in the multiplayer section.
We have seenF1titles on handhelds before, but neveras polished asF1 22. Players can enjoy this excellent racing game at 60fps with good graphics. Lower the frame rate andF1fans will get an even better experience. This terrific racer is well worth owning on the Deck.
What makesAsphalt Legends Unitestand out from all the other games listed here is the fact that it is free-to-play. The game is a massive visual leap over the mobile-onlyAsphaltentries, and it comes with a huge number of cars that can be purchased with in-game progress.
The game focuses on circuit-based races rather than being an open world, but the multiplayer section is quite fun and challenging, as players attempt to win and rank up. However, keep in mind that the monetization model does include some pay-to-win elements, which allows some players to upgrade their vehicles earlier than others.
